Gabe’s hiring 150

Workers needed to staff remodeled Rugged Wearhouse in Fort Oglethorpe

The former Rugged Wearhouse in Fort Oglethorpe will reopen next month as a bigger, rebranded discount fashion store known as Gabe’s.

The West Virginia-based retail chain is seeking applicants this week to fill 150 full- and part-time jobs the new store will need when it opens on Oct. 21. Dean Stead, district manager for Gabes, said Tuesday the new store is hiring cashiers, clerks, warehouse workers and other retail positions during a job fair which continues today from 9 a.m. to 7 p.m. and Thursday from 9 a.m. to 1 p.m. at the Hampton Inn, 6875 Battlefiel­d Parkway, just down the parkway from the store undergoing remodeling.

The Rugged Wearhouse at 791 Battlefiel­d Parkway opened in 2007 but was shut down in July to convert the store into a bigger Gabe’s location. Employees at the former Rugged Wearhouse store in Fort Oglethorpe were offered positions at the Rugged Wearhouse in Chattanoog­a, Stead said.

“We opened up nearly twice as much space (at the former Rugged Wearhouse in Fort Oglethorpe) and we’ll be offering home furnishing­s and far more merchandis­e, clothing, shoes and other items,” Stead said.

The new store will include about 42,000 square feet and is among several Rugged Wearhouse locations being converted to larger Gabe’s outlets.

Gabe’s, formerly Gabriel Brothers Inc., was founded in 1961 and is a private discount fashion retailer headquarte­red in Morgantown, W.Va. The company operates Gabe’s stores throughout Delaware, Kentucky, Maryland, North Carolina, Ohio, Pennsylvan­ia, Tennessee, South Carolina, Virginia and West Virginia.

The company also operates 39 Rugged Wearhouse stores in 10 states.

Gabe’s sells designer brands and fashions for up to 70 percent off department and specialty store prices. Their stores carry designer brand name ladies, juniors, lingerie, men’s and children’s apparel, along with footwear, accessorie­s, handbags, bath and beauty products, home décor, soft home, electronic­s and housewares.
